The Great Crayola Experiment






This Idea Came From: What a cool idea!  http://grinandbakeit.com/valentines-crayon-hearts-craft

Our Experience:  Oh my word... I do not know what I was thinking!  These crayolas are still in that letter muffin cast iron thingy.Weeks later... still trying to figure out how to get them out!

The Lesson: Do Not use anything other than silicone, flexible bake wear... unless you like the challenge. As for me.. I would love to hear any ideas how to get this out of my muffin cast iron tin. So far... I tried somewhat remelting, flash freezing in snow, a knife and also... standing over it swearing directly at it... that didn't work either.
